Difference Between Electric And Induction Cooktop. What’s the difference between induction and electric cooktops? The main difference between these two types of cooktops is the heating element that is used. Electric cooktops use a heat source to cook your food, whereas induction cooktops use electromagnets to help you boil, simmer and fry to perfection.
